What is the difference between
taxing
to regulate trade and taxing to raise
revenue?
Answer:
Taxing to regulate trade is done to reduce the amount of a good that is purchased. Such taxes are usually higher than taxation for revenue as they are done to make the good so expensive that certain people will be unable to afford it. For instance, the alcohol levy of Botswana that was up to 40% at some point.
Taxation to raise revenue on the other hand, is not too high - as the government does not wat to restrict sales - and is simply imposed so the government can earn some revenue on goods sold. These can include Value Added Taxes for instance.

What is the Grand Canal?
Answer:
Explanation:
It was built to enable successive Chinese regimes to transport surplus grain from the agriculturally rich Yangtze (Chang) and Huai river valleys to feed the capital cities and large standing armies in northern China. Cargo barges on the Grand Canal at Suzhou, Jiangsu province, China.
Or you could put
The canal was built in order to easily ship grain from the rich farmland in southern China to the capital city in Beijing. This also helped the emperors to feed the soldiers guarding the northern borders. The Ancient Chinese built early canals to help with transportation and commerce.

describe the pattern of immigration To America during the 19th century? For example which groups came in where did they come from?
Answer:
The answer is below
Explanation:
The pattern of immigration to America during the 19th century has European people particularly the Irish moving from their country to settle in the United States in a location near their point of entry along the East Coast. There were about 4 million Irish immigrants that moved to the United States during this period.
Also, during the 19th century, a large number of Germans immigrated to the United States. The immigration records showed about 5 million germans immigrated.

After the passage of the Indian Citizenship Act of 1924, American Indians
were:
A. Unable to keep living on tribal lands.
O B. Forced to pay a poll tax to vote.
O C. Only able to vote in local elections.
O D. Given full U.S. citizenship.
Answer:
Given full U.S. citizenship.
All non-citizen Indians born within the borders of the United States are officially declared citizens of the United States after the enactment of the Indian Citizenship Act of 1924. Thus, option D is correct.
What is the Indian Citizenship Act of 1924?On June 2, 1924, President Calvin Coolidge signed the Indian Citizenship Act of 1924, granting all Native American Indians citizenship in the United States.
The Fourteenth Amendment granted citizenship to all other people born in the country but not to Native Americans, whose status had been distributed irregularly based on their ancestry, gender, marital status, and relationship to their tribe.
A portion of the reason the Indian Citizenship Act was passed was to honor American Indian soldiers who had served in World War I.
Native Americans received citizenship, but they were not given the vote. Congress granted all Native Americans automatic U.S. citizenship in 1924.
